Grease Build-Up / Element Contamination
Strong burning smell or smoke from oven during normal cooking (not first use).

Possible Causes
Heavy grease on elements or cavity surfaces, food debris on bottom panel, spillage on grill element, degraded insulation smoking
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: If smoke is heavy, switch off the oven and ventilate the room. Do not leave the oven unattended.
- Inspect cavity: When cool, remove racks and trays. Check for burnt-on food or grease, especially near elements and on the bottom panel.
- Clean thoroughly: Use a non-caustic oven cleaner suitable for enamel surfaces. Avoid spraying directly on elements; instead, wipe them gently with a damp cloth when cool.
- Check insulation: If the smell is chemical or persists after cleaning, inspect around the elements and rear panel for burnt insulation or wiring. Replace any damaged insulation or wiring.
- Burn-in cycle: After cleaning, run the oven empty at a moderate temperature for 30–60 minutes to burn off residues, with good ventilation.
